The International Conference on Marine Bioinvasions (ICMB) is an international forum in which scientists and policy makers from around the world meet to review current challenges in the global management of invasive marine organisms and to share new developments in science and policy. 
 
The ICMB is organized every two years with the purpose to facilitate the exchange of ideas and research results among scientists and policy makers from around the world about marine invasive species.
